Bloody Message
written by lpcrawlinggrl
02:57 AM 3/13/05
It happened to me
I started it all
Don't say it wasn't
I know it was my fault

I lied to you
So many times
But this started it
This secret was the worst find

I did it to myself purposely
And I told you
But I know I shouldn't have
Then it happened to you too

I tried to stop just then
But then you told me
I started so heavily
You just wouldn't believe

You think I won't understand
You'll keep going
You told me to quit
You still want yours flowing

Have you no clue
This hurts me so much
Emotionally and physically
It's holding us in clutch

I can't stand seeing you hurt
I know I did this first
This was all my doing
I know that I'm the worst

I won't leave you behind
I'll reach the deep shock
Tell you how horrible it is
Maybe you'll slow with me and walk

We think this is better
But we should have just talked it out
Realize this is wrong
I'm not one to shout

Writing a message
Straight from inside
This is the worst thing
We could ever try to hide

I'll stop with you
But I can't force you to listen
I want to help you so much
But I can't if you're too deep in

If I'm without you
I'll be more lost than I am
Losing what little I had
Something I can't stand

Listen to me
I am always here
Please just talk to me
We can make this all disappear

I'll help you through
So please help me
We'll wash away this bloody message
Of pain, lies, and secrecy
